引言:区块链的崛起与未来
区块链,这个近年来在全球范围内引起巨大轰动的技术,已经逐渐从神秘的领域走进了大众的视野。它不仅是一种技术,更是一种全新的理念,正在改变着我们的生活方式和商业模式。本文将带您从入门到精通,深入了解区块链的核心技术要点。
一、区块链的起源与发展
1.1 起源:比特币的诞生
区块链的起源可以追溯到2008年,当时一位化名为中本聪的人发表了比特币的白皮书,提出了区块链的概念。比特币作为一种去中心化的数字货币,其底层技术——区块链,因此诞生。
1.2 发展:从比特币到广泛应用
随着比特币的兴起,区块链技术逐渐被更多领域关注。如今,区块链已经从金融领域扩展到供应链、医疗、教育等多个行业,展现出巨大的应用潜力。
二、区块链的基本原理
2.1 区块
区块链由一系列按时间顺序排列的区块组成。每个区块包含一定数量的交易记录,以及一个时间戳和一个前一个区块的哈希值。
2.2 哈希算法
哈希算法是区块链的核心技术之一。它可以将任意长度的数据转换成固定长度的哈希值,保证了数据的唯一性和不可篡改性。
2.3 工作量证明(PoW)
工作量证明是一种确保网络安全的机制。在比特币中,矿工通过解决复杂的数学问题来获得新的区块,从而获得比特币奖励。
三、区块链的核心技术要点
3.1 去中心化
区块链的去中心化是其最显著的特点。它通过分布式账本技术,实现了数据的共享和共识,避免了中心化系统可能出现的单点故障和中心化风险。
3.2 透明性
区块链上的数据对所有参与者都是透明的,任何人都可以查看交易记录。这种透明性保证了数据的真实性和可信度。
3.3 安全性
区块链的安全性主要得益于其哈希算法和共识机制。哈希算法保证了数据的不可篡改性,而共识机制则确保了网络的安全性和稳定性。
3.4 可扩展性
区块链的可扩展性是其面临的一大挑战。随着参与者的增多,区块链的处理速度和容量可能会受到影响。为了解决这个问题,研究者们提出了多种扩容方案,如分片、侧链等。
四、区块链的应用案例
4.1 金融领域
在金融领域,区块链技术可以用于跨境支付、供应链金融、数字货币等场景。例如,比特币和以太坊等数字货币就是基于区块链技术的。
4.2 供应链管理
区块链技术可以用于追踪商品的来源、流向和状态,提高供应链的透明度和效率。例如,沃尔玛等大型零售商已经开始在供应链管理中使用区块链技术。
4.3 医疗领域
区块链技术可以用于病历管理、药品溯源、医疗支付等场景。例如,美国医疗保健公司MediChain正在利用区块链技术提高医疗数据的透明度和安全性。
五、区块链的未来展望
随着技术的不断发展和应用场景的拓展,区块链技术将在未来发挥越来越重要的作用。以下是一些可能的未来发展趋势:
5.1 技术创新
区块链技术仍在不断发展,未来可能会有更多创新性的技术出现,如量子区块链、跨链技术等。
5.2 应用拓展
区块链技术将在更多领域得到应用,如物联网、智能合约、数字身份等。
5.3 法规政策
随着区块链技术的普及,各国政府将逐步出台相关法规政策,以规范区块链技术的发展和应用。
结语:区块链,改变未来的力量
区块链技术作为一种颠覆性的创新,正在改变着我们的世界。掌握区块链的核心技术要点,有助于我们更好地理解和应用这一技术,为未来的发展做好准备。让我们一起期待区块链技术带来的美好未来!
